Thursday, October 21, 2010

I admit i was a total sucker for the scream films when I was young.

This trailer has me totally pumped to see them back in action.  Now when do i get my sequal to The Craft.

1 comment:

Brahm (alfred lives here) said...

Love it, saw the preview on tv last night and CANNOT WAIT!!!!